Technical Advantages You Can't Ignore
Let's cut through the jargon: what makes these panels special? The secret sauce lies in their monocrystalline PERC cells and optimized cell spacing. Compared to older models, they deliver:
Specification | 430W Panel | 400W Panel |
---|---|---|
Conversion Efficiency | 21.2% | 19.8% |
Temperature Coefficient | -0.35%/°C | -0.40%/°C |
Real-World Application: A Case Study
Take a 50kW commercial installation in Spain. Using 430W panels reduced required roof space by 18% compared to 400W models. The numbers speak volumes:
- Annual energy production: 72,300 kWh
- Payback period: 4.2 years
- CO2 reduction: 32 tonnes annually

Global Market Outlook
The International Energy Agency reports solar capacity grew 22% YoY in 2023. High-efficiency panels now account for 38% of new installations – up from just 12% in 2020.

FAQ: Quick Answers to Common Questions
Q: How long do these panels typically last? Most manufacturers offer 25-year performance warranties with 80%+ output guarantee.
Q: Do they perform well in cloudy conditions? Yes – modern panels maintain 15-25% output even under heavy cloud cover.
Q: What maintenance is required? Basic cleaning 2-4 times annually and routine system checks.
